Why the Premium name is confusing
Premium is often used as a shortcut for any paid version of Duolingo. That is understandable, but it can blur the real decision.
When buying today, you should compare the current plan benefits: Super for core premium features, Max for the AI layer.
Super vs Max is the real buying decision
Super is the right choice if you want the free app to feel smoother: no ads, unlimited hearts, and fewer practice interruptions.
Max is the right choice if you want AI-supported explanation and practice, and if those features are available for the course you care about.
- Choose Super for lower-cost premium convenience
- Choose Max for AI help and more active practice
- Do not pay for Max if you will not use the AI layer

FAQ
Is Duolingo Premium the same as Super? +
People often use Premium to mean Super, but Super is the clearer current plan name for the core paid Duolingo experience.
What is Duolingo Plus? +
Plus is older or legacy wording that users still search. In most buying decisions, you should compare current Super and Max benefits instead.
Is Max better than Super? +
Max has more features, but it is only better if you will use AI explanation and interactive practice. Otherwise Super is usually the better value.
